Unable to install Plesk via Web Installer: handshake failed: ssh: unable to authenticate, attempted methods [none password], no supported methods remain

Plesk for Linux kb: technical Plesk Obsidian for Linux

Applicable to:

  • Plesk for Linux

Symptoms

  • Unable to install Plesk through Web Installer:

    CONFIG_TEXT: Cannot connect to ssh host example.com: ssh: handshake failed: ssh: unable to authenticate, attempted methods [none password], no supported methods remain

  • Root/Password authentication is chosen.

Cause

Specified credentials (username/password) are not correct.

Resolution

Confirm with hosting provider/cloud vendor the correct credentials and use them at Web Installer.
